What the ratings mean

NHTSA gives the 2020 Chevrolet Impala 5 out of 5 stars overall, level with the 5-star median for the 6 comparable 2020 vehicles NHTSA rated in this class.

NHTSA published results for every NCAP test in this program, so the overall star rating rests on a complete set of crash and rollover results.

NHTSA's dynamic test put this vehicle's rollover probability at 12.1% in a single-vehicle crash — the figure behind the rollover star rating, published here because the star alone hides how wide each band is.

How this compares

At 22 MPG combined, the 2020 Chevrolet Impala ranks 7th of 8 large cars EPA rated for 2020 — 2 MPG short of the 24 MPG median for that group.

That places it among the thirstiest vehicles in its class. If annual mileage is high, the running-cost gap against a class-average rival compounds quickly.

EPA puts annual fuel spend at about $2,800, $150 more than the $2,650 typical for the class. Over five years at 15,000 miles a year that is roughly $14,000, a $750 difference against a class-median vehicle.

Tailpipe CO₂ is 406 grams per mile — about 6.1 metric tons over 15,000 miles of driving.
